    Side Skirt Fitment Question

    I while back I acquired a set of 2 piece Pfeba side skirts, that I was told came off an e30. They fit the fender arches perfectly, but seem to come up a bit short where they are supposed to join at the seam (about a couple inches).

    This is on a 1986 325es.

    Is it possible that these are for a convertible instead? Do the verts have a shorter rocker section? I was thinking maybe they were for a late model, but I know that late IS skirts will fit an early coupe so I'm thinking that is not the case. And 4 door and coupes are the same too?

    Any input would be appreciated.

    #2
    The rear wheel arches on early models are the same as convertibles, so your skirts are probably for a late model e30, which had the lower rear wheel arches.
